WebSep 1, 2024 · Stopping this medication may result in a return of symptoms such as: Fatigue. Weight gain. Difficulty tolerating cold. Dry skin. Thinning hair. This medication should not be discontinued without talking to your physician first. The longer you go without taking your medication, … recipes for punch for partiesWebAn underactive thyroid (hypothyroidism) is usually treated by taking daily hormone replacement tablets called levothyroxine. Levothyroxine replaces the thyroxine hormone, which your thyroid does not make enough of.. You'll initially have regular blood tests until the correct dose of levothyroxine is reached. This can take a little while to get right. unscaled bookWebDec 10, 2024 · Don't skip doses or stop taking the medicine because you feel better.
